V8 Jeep Wrangler on 35's . . . running fast on a road corse (vid)
Well, I found this interesting. You guys might know AEV (American Expedition Vehicles) as they develop some pretty bad-ass Wranglers. Usually it's a very well designed suspension system and a Hemi V8 all put together in an OEM-level engineered and fabricated package.
Here is their JK Wrangler version:
Anyways, some guys at Overland Journal took it out to a road corse to see how well it does on the pavement as they already know how well it does on the trail. Given that it's a high COG offroad machines it seems to do ok. I'm impressed.

Yeah, no kidding.
IIRC, I think the stock JK 4-door weighs somewhere north of 5,000 lb. Then AEV adds 35" tires which are ~67 lb. ea + ~25-30 lb per wheel or ~95 lb. of unsprung weight per corner. Then they add more weight with all the HD steel bumpers, swing out tire carrier, armor, etc. Then add the V8 engine. And the whole thing is rolling around on solid axles front and rear that probably represent about 250 lb. ea of unsprung weight. Anyways, it impressed me. AEV is well known for a very high level of R&D, engineering, and quality. It might be silly but this vid is an indication of that. And you get what you pay for. In this case it's probably about as close to a factory turn-key product as you're going to get. They have also done this, which I think they are gearing up for production, soon-ish:
